Biological
Perspective: Masters of Adaptation
From a biological standpoint, parasites
are extraordinary examples of evolution. Whether it's tapeworms, lice, or
protozoa like Plasmodium (which causes malaria), parasites have evolved
intricate ways to survive inside their hosts. They can manipulate immune
systems, change their form during life cycles, and spread across populations
with efficiency. Studying parasites offers insight into host-pathogen
coevolution, survival tactics, and genetic adaptation—making them key players
in understanding life itself.
Medical
Perspective: Hidden Threats to Human Health
Parasites are a major concern in
global health, especially in tropical and developing regions. Diseases like
malaria, giardiasis, and schistosomiasis affect millions every year. Intestinal
worms and other parasitic infections can cause long-term nutritional
deficiencies, developmental delays, and chronic illness. In developed
countries, parasites are often overlooked but still present, particularly among
travelers or in immunocompromised individuals. Prevention through sanitation,
awareness, and medical intervention is crucial in reducing their impact.
Ecological
Perspective: Balancing Ecosystems
Though they are often maligned,
parasites serve important ecological roles. They can regulate animal
populations, control biodiversity, and influence food webs. For instance, some
parasites limit the dominance of certain species, allowing others to thrive.
Parasites also act as natural checks that prevent overpopulation and resource
depletion. Their presence is often a sign of a functioning ecosystem, even
though it might seem counterintuitive.

Technological
& Research Perspective: Future Frontiers
New technologies such as genomic
sequencing, CRISPR, and AI are revolutionizing how we study parasites.
Researchers can now decode parasitic genomes, track transmission in real time,
and develop targeted treatments or vaccines. These advances promise not only to
reduce parasitic diseases but also to use parasitic mechanisms for beneficial
purposes—like treating autoimmune disorders or targeting cancer cells. The
future of parasite research holds promise beyond simply eradication.
